Grandpa Passed Away And We Don't Know Where The Will Is But Current Wife Might Be Evicting Us From Childhood Home

[Location: Los Angeles, CA] My grandpa just passed away about a month ago and the funeral was just held this past week. Since then, I have asked a few of my older family members who live/lived in my home. I have lived here my whole life (almost 21 years) but my grandapa had remarried when I was young (around 4-6 y/o). His current wife has made comments about selling the house and her being in charge of the house now but no one seems to have any information for me regarding the house's ownership.

As far as I'm aware, the original will stated that the bottom half of the house would go to my dad and the top half would go to my uncle as my grandpa had originally built the top half almost 50 years ago for my uncle. My father passed away first so that ownership was meant to be passed off to my mother and me when my grandpa would pass next.

Now, we are unsure of what to do and if she has the right to take ownership over the house. I have lived in this house longer than she has and as it is my childhood, originally built for our family with my grandpa's first wife.

Is there anything I can do as we fear if she does have ownership, she will be evicting us.
